Why Choose Eco Friendly Baby Products?

Babies are sensitive—and so is our planet. Many traditional baby items contain harmful chemicals, synthetic materials, or are designed for single-use, contributing to pollution and landfill waste. Eco friendly baby products are:

  • Non-toxic and free from harsh chemicals like BPA, phthalates, and parabens

  • Sustainably sourced from organic cotton, bamboo, or biodegradable materials

  • Reusable or compostable, reducing overall waste

  • Safer for baby’s skin, and better for the Earth

According to the Environmental Working Group (EWG), babies are more vulnerable to environmental toxins, making conscious choices more important than ever.

Baby Eco FAQ: What Parents Ask Most

Q: Are eco-friendly baby products safe for newborns?
A: Yes! In fact, they’re often safer. They avoid harsh chemicals, artificial dyes, and fragrances that can irritate sensitive skin.

Q: Are reusable diapers hard to use?
A: Not anymore. Modern cloth diapers come with snaps, liners, and washing guides that make them parent-friendly and leak-resistant.

Q: How do I know a product is truly eco-friendly?
A: Look for third-party certifications like:

  • G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ard)

  • OEKO-TEX

  • USDA Organic

  • Certified B Corp

Pro Tips for First-Time Eco Parents

  1. Start small – You don’t have to swap everything at once. Start with diapers or wipes.

  2. Buy secondhand – Clothes, cribs, and toys can be reused (just avoid used car seats).

  3. Make your own – DIY baby wipes and balms can be cost-effective and customizable.

  4. Use less – Minimalism and sustainability go hand-in-hand. Babies don’t need 50 outfits.

The Future of Sustainable Baby Products

With new technology and growing demand, eco baby products are becoming more accessible than ever. In fact:

  • Walmart, Target, and Amazon now carry dozens of green baby lines

  • New brands are using corn-based plastics, plant inks, and compostable packaging

  • Subscription services like Dyper offer home delivery for bamboo diapers with carbon offsets
